Removal from Storage
1. Remove the spark plug; check that it is clean and
properly
gapped (p. 26). Pull the starter rope
several times.
2. Thread the spark plug in as far as possible by hand,
then use the plug wrench to tighten l/8 to l/4 turn
further.
3. Check the engine oil level and condition.
4. Fill the fuel tank and start the engine.
NOTE:
If the cylinder was coated with oil, the engine will
smoke at start up; this is normal.
